Mountain climber rescued by helicopter after fall on Mount Udalatx

The 33-year-old woman was evacuated to Galdakao hospital with a foot injury sustained near the summit.

Emergency Services of the Basque Government rescued a 33-year-old female climber on Mount Udalatx (Arrasate) this Sunday, after she fell and injured her foot.

The incident occurred near the mountain's summit, where the woman, who was hiking in the area, fell and sustained a foot injury that prevented her from continuing on her own.
The alert was received by Sos Deiak 112 shortly after eleven in the morning. Following the alert, a technician from the Directorate of Emergency Care of the Basque Government dispatched a helicopter from the Ertzaintza with agents from the Mountain Section of the Surveillance and Rescue Unit (UVR).
The aircraft carried out the rescue of the victim, a Spanish national, who was subsequently transferred to Galdakao hospital for treatment of her injuries.
